Output 53acb78d507a4ec148e3245932ec60890e21c9f1526ab6ccfa8b41647c656025:1

value
39449028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b922778285d2eea8c3eeacccfcaaea9571bd06 OP_EQUAL
address
MDSEZKWru2ZBjK62ggJymH9UMw4fiwRc7S
transaction
53acb78d507a4ec148e3245932ec60890e21c9f1526ab6ccfa8b41647c656025
spent
true